The first record of the installation of an efficient, continuously-operating, coal-washing appliance in England (to wash slack for coking at a colliery at Newcastle-upon-Tyne) dates from 1849 and a similar (Bérard-type) washer had been erected for the Wigan Coal & Iron Company by 1868.

A coal preparation plant (CPP; also known as a coal handling and preparation plant (CHPP), coal handling plant, prep plant, tipple or wash plant) is a facility that washes coal of soil and rock, crushes it into graded sized chunks (sorting), stockpiles grades preparing it for transport to market, and more often than not, also loads coal into rail cars, barges, or ships.
At Wirral, as at most other collieries, coal-washing was restricted to small coal (slack) where the value of 'dirt' separation was most financially viable. The coal fed to the trough was '..all that will pass through a screen with 1 inch and 1¼ inches parallel bars; the dust, peas, beans, and nuts all being mixed together.

The practice of washing coal for coking was used to some degree from the very beginning of industrial development in the Birmingham District. Washing was necessary to efficiently produce the quality of coke needed in blast furnaces. Although the lump coal could be coked as it came from the mines, the slack coal, 3/4** mesh, was of little value.
Coal washing was first practised in Europe, and as early as 1826 slack coal was step-washed in the valley of the Tharandt near Dresden, Saxony. The step washer was an early form of the trough washer and owed its name to the presence of two inclined planes, or "steps," in the bottom of its trough.

An 1884 report on the mine stated, "The coal was run from the pit mouth into the boats at the river by means of a large and small chute. A screen was placed in the small chute next to the boats. The lump coal was the only portion loaded for market, and the slack, or the portion that passes through the screen, was cast aside as worthless."
